Получить DataTable из существующей диаграммы визуализации Google - PullRequest
1 голос
/ 16 января 2012

Я нарисовал таблицу таблиц визуализации Google. Как я могу получить DataTable, который используется для рисования диаграммы? Например, как получить значение первых 5 строк и столбца 1.

1 Ответ

1 голос
/ 16 января 2012

Если вы используете ChartWrapper , вы можете получить DataTable следующим образом:

  var wrapper = new google.visualization.ChartWrapper({
    chartType: 'ColumnChart',
    dataTable: [['Germany', 'USA', 'Brazil', 'Canada', 'France', 'RU'],
                [700, 300, 400, 500, 600, 800]],
    options: {'title': 'Countries'},
    containerId: 'visualization'
  });
  wrapper.draw();
  // get the DT
  var dt = wrapper.getDataTable();
  console.log(dt);

Если вы хотите получить значение из DataTable, вы можете использовать getValue(rowIndex, columnIndex) метод DataTable:

var dt = wrapper.getDataTable();
alert(dt.getValue(3, 1));
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...